How long have you been using Microsoft Dynamics Ax?

Toplam Sayfa Görüntüleme Sayısı

Popular Posts

Translate

Bu Blogda Ara

21 Kasım 2012 Çarşamba

Group by on lookup

Hi,

When we need to group by the query values on lookup we need to use parmUseLookupValue(false) method.


public void lookup()
{
    SysTableLookup sysTableLookup;
    Query q = new Query();
    ;
    sysTableLookup  = SysTableLookup::newParameters(tablenum(TableName),this);
    q.addDataSource(tablenum(TableName)).orderMode(OrderMode::GroupBy);
    q.dataSourceTable(tablenum(TableName)).addGroupByField(fieldnum(TableName,FieldName));
    sysTableLookup.addLookupfield(fieldnum(TableName,FieldName));
    sysTableLookup.parmUseLookupValue(false);
    sysTableLookup.parmQuery(q);
    sysTableLookup.performFormLookup();
}

Have a nice coding with AX.

Hiç yorum yok:

Yorum Gönder